Zimbabwean Prophet Wins $30,000 at Casino, Receives Ban

Prophet Archbishop Emmanuel Mutumwa, leader of the Johanne Masowe eChishanu Apostolic Sect, has been banned from casinos in Zimbabwe after winning a staggering $30,000 at a local outlet.

The prophet attributes his win to a vision from God, which he claims provided him with the winning formula.

According to Prophet Mutumwa, his win was the largest ever recorded at the casino, breaking the previous record by almost double.

He celebrated his victory by using the winnings to pay school fees for some of his church members and provide start-up funds for their businesses.

However, his joy was short-lived, as he was subsequently banned from other casinos for “winning too much.”

Casino managers claim that Prophet Mutumwa’s consistent wins are a result of his alleged ability to receive visions from God, giving him an unfair advantage.

They fear that if he continues to win, it could lead to financial instability for the casinos.

The prophet, however, defends his winnings, stating that gambling, when done responsibly, can be a source of good fortune that can be channelled towards helping others.

Prophet Mutumwa reveals that many people seek his spiritual guidance on winning lottery games, at casinos, or when placing bets, and many have reported winning more frequently since seeking his guidance.

He believes that his win was a test of faith and a blessing from God to uplift his congregation.

A local casino manager confirmed that betting establishments typically restrict or close accounts of those who win consistently to protect their financial stability.
